Abstract
The binding properties of dibenzo-18-crown-6 ether (BTB, 1) and napthobenzo-18-crown-6 ether (NTB, 2), containing two thiazole units toward mono, and divalent cations, are outlined. The ion-selective properties of 1 and 2 were studied by measuring their fluorescent emission responses to alkali, alkaline earth, and transition metal ions. BTB (1) showed the highest binding constant toward Ag+ over Pb2+, Hg2+, and Cu2+. NTB (2) revealed a high selectivity toward Ag+ over Pb2+, Hg2+, and Cu2+.
